The Miami Symphony Orchestra (MISO), led by its Music Director & CEO, Maestro Eduardo Marturet, and the Board of Directors, announced today the appointment of the legendary Emilio Estefan as its new Chairman. This historic collaboration marks the beginning of an exciting new era for MISO, as the world-renowned producer, composer, and entrepreneur brings his unparalleled expertise, vision, and passion for the arts to the orchestra.
The official announcement was made by Miami-Dade County Mayor Daniella Levine Cava at a press conference held at MISO Headquarters in the Miami Design District. Mayor Levine Cava expressed her excitement, stating, “It is a moment of great pride for Miami-Dade County to welcome Emilio Estefan as the new Chairman of The Miami Symphony Orchestra.”

In addition to celebrating Emilio Estefan’s appointment, MISO proudly honored Rafael Diaz-Balart as Chairman Emeritus for his 31 years of dedicated service to the orchestra. His unwavering support and leadership have been instrumental in MISO’s growth and continued excellence in the arts.
As Chairman, Estefan will prioritize expanding MISO’s outreach programs, developing strategic partnerships, and ensuring the orchestra’s continued success as a beacon of artistic excellence in Miami and beyond.
